Transaction 34d01e16cecedf563a8db9ef724fbd06de6bbcfc806022e66832c839fa76d6b4
1 Input
1 Output
-
34d01e16cecedf563a8db9ef724fbd06de6bbcfc806022e66832c839fa76d6b4:0
- value
- 99933138
- script pubkey
- OP_0 OP_PUSHBYTES_20 663d33aff0c6a2d77a58214421a8e82966bba539
- address
- bc1qvc7n8tlsc63dw7jcy9zzr28g99nthffeftz0n3